Chronic Tacos hosts grand opening Saturday in downtown Spokane
Tue., Jan. 30, 2018
Chronic Tacos opened in downtown Spokane at the end of November. Saturday, the fast-casual chain celebrates its grand opening with live music, giveaways and an appearance by Jason “Wee Man” Acun, a Chronic Tacos franchisee who appears in the movie “Jackass.”
The grand opening event runs from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. Saturday at the downtown Chronic Tacos, 524 W. Main Ave.
The first 20 people in line get a free taco every week for a year. A limited number of other early-arrivers will also receive a free taco that day.
Founded in 2002, Chronic Tacos is a California-inspired Mexican grill that has more than 50 locations in North America. For more information, visit chronictacos.com.
